From Juan Luis Guerra, who initially to Jazz, and thanks to the sound of bachata has had a long and respectable musical career, and managed descarse as an artist in that genre.

Later I heard that sound, in a sadder version of the voice of groups like Aventura (which I never was a fan), but whose lyrics reflect the Latino society, their sufferings and every day, stories of real life accompanied a tropical sound.

Then I met some songs Romeo Santos (lead singer of Aventura) who went solo, making way for artists such as Prince Royce, who versionó the legendary theme Stand By Me, popularized by iconic figures of music like BE King and John Lennon .

Interestingly, I managed to hear the full album Prince Royce, the sound of the sea caught me on December 1 in Higuerote.

One human being is connected with the sounds that are around and voluntarily phone to hear it or not but wherever I went that pace was heard, I liked more than the songs of Aventura.

The full album Prince Royce is an ideal of how to popularize a genre or how sound are amplified example. That rubs bachata pop in a very obvious way, includes mostly songs of love and heartbreak, a soft melody and something danceable.

I daresay that helped bachata cool the Latin pop whose market was dominated by Reggaeton music and sounds created with computer, very common today.

Although it seems that all the songs Bachata are equal and this song does not define the sound of the album Prince Royce, that letter and that sound not only helps the artist born in New York is expressed in Spanish, but allows him to express considering a Latino audience.

Through this theme allows countries of Central and South America achieved also connect through music. It also breaks the monotony in the structures of the songs and sounds from other groups Bachata.

How? While Bachata is a genre that emerged in the Dominican Republic, with an influence and instruments of bolero and took into account ranchera music, a genre that is rooted in Mexico.

Personally ranchera is a very romantic genre, reflects culture, tradition, and so is the mostly Latino audience.

A love song, a tropical sound, fused with a kind of romantic type, traditional, played by an artist whose voice is like you whisper in her ear. Items required before an audience accustomed to the direct language of Reggaeton and also can dance apretadito.
